„Holding Pattern" Exhibition Now Open

After six weeks of renovations, the wait is finally over: On 14 March 2025, the HMKV Hartware MedienKunstVerein celebrated the grand opening of the international group exhibition Holding Pattern (15 March – 27 July 2025). The exhibition is now open to the public and can be visited free of charge.

Curated by acclaimed writer Tom McCarthy and author and curator Anne Hilde Neset, the exhibition explores patterns of movement, loops, and repetitions that shape our daily lives. It features six outstanding artistic positions by Åke Hodell, Stan Douglas, Harun Farocki, Stefan Panhans & Andrea Winkler, Susan Philipsz, and Elizabeth Price.

With his literary focus on technological and media phenomena, Tom McCarthy reflects key themes of HMKV, which examines the intersections between art, technology, and society.

The exhibition runs until 27 July 2025 and is accompanied by a diverse programme of public guided tours, artist talks, book presentations, concerts, workshops, and film screenings.
